Output ed2d6a520721102e9752f30ab2311a97ad3de401bda9491606aab0edc368eb71:0

value
89860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dacb9cde5a63e73d71ee0a5da38b3242160bffc OP_EQUAL
address
3JyvYzsMJYFaJUBV51QYTMZpXJWpumudVw
transaction
ed2d6a520721102e9752f30ab2311a97ad3de401bda9491606aab0edc368eb71
spent
true